Pakistan piled up 175-5 after electing to bat and then restricted the reigning World Twenty20 champions to 146-7 in the day-night match at the Premadasa Stadium.
Afridi looked happy for winning the toss, he said, “A good hard surface”. Sri Lanka’s inability to hit the right lengths proved costly as Lasith Malinga, the captain, went for 46 off his four overs to finish as the most expensive bowler.

Debutant Dhananjaya de Silva looked promising during his knock of 31 and another youngster Milinda Siriwardana made 35, before Chamara Kapugedera justified his recall with three sixes in his unbeaten 31 off 16 balls.
The home side is dominated by newcomers and returnees and they will rely heavily on the experience of skipper Lasith Malinga, all-rounder Angelo Mathews and veteran opener Tillakaratne Dilshan.
